#b4d7e1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4d7e1 is composed of 70.6% red, 84.3%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20% cyan, 4.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 193.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 79.4%. #b4d7e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#69afc3.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#b4d7e1 color description : Light grayish cyan.
#b4d7e1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4d7e1 has RGB values of R:180, G:215,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 11851745.

Shades and Tints of #b4d7e1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040809 is the darkest color, while #fafc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4d7e1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8cccd is the less saturated color, while #98e7fd is the most saturated one.
